Kurta: Conventional Outfit with a Touch of Flamboyance

Kurta is essentially a shirt or top which is longer than the ideal shirt. The simplicity in design and the comfort it offers, makes the Kurta; popular clothing in India. Kurta is also an essential part of fusion clothing- an emerging trend.
The highly acclaimed kurta can be categorized as follows:
Kurta for men: Men's Kurta may be categorized as casual wear and formal wear depending on the fabric and designs. Men` Kurta made from khadi, cotton or nylon is typically worn as casual wear. A kurta is the most preferred outfit for events like puja and traditional get-together. Devout Muslims in India wear kurta for special prayer sessions. Kurtas not only have an innate ethnicity but are comfortable and ideal for summers as well. Men's Kurta in silk or satin is apt for Indian formal wear. They often have embroidery, sequin or beads adorning the sleeves and neck.
Kurta for women: Women's Kurta come in varied patterns, fabric and trimmings. Women's Kurta used as casual wear is generally made of cotton and the very Indian khadi fabric. Their elegance is enhanced with suitable designs obtained by printing or dyeing. Sanganeri prints, hand block prints, tie and dye are a few of the designs often seen in the very Indian Women's Kurta, that often make up the casual wear category.
Women's kurta categorized under party wear, comprise kurtas exclusively made of silk and festooned with intricate designs. This type of Women's kurta may be worn with straight cut bottoms or the traditional Punjabi bottom. Women's Kurta with bold prints; made ornate with beads and teamed with suitable jewellery make appropriate party wear kurta.
Fusion-wear kurta: A blend of eastern and western outfits is popularly known as fusion dressing. Kurta when teamed with jeans or trousers give the fusion look. They may be complemented with a stole or scarf. Fusion wear kurta is preferably made from fabrics festooned with bold prints, block prints or contemporary designs. Earth shades suit the whole concept of fusion better. White is also a preferred color for fusion wear kurta, more so if it is accessorized with beads and other trinkets.
Designer Kurta: As the name suggests, designer kurta is specifically designed to accentuate a particular, style and approach towards fashion. Designer kurta is often accompanied with bold unconventional prints and novel designs on light fabric.
Designer kurta with an ethnic touch and a fabric that complements the ethnicity, like silk or chiffon can be idyllically worn as party wear. Designer kurta when teamed with suitable accessories and a western bottom transforms to fusion wear. Designer kurta may be conventional or contemporary depending mainly on the designer, the particular market it is crafted for and sometimes the brand.
Kurta is an emerging fashion concept. Although it was popular since the early nineteenth century, the contemporary touch and novel designs have made them an integral part of the wardrobe today.
